How Cache works in Drupal

Caching process is done with the help of cache.inc file

cache_clear_all [ cache_clear_all($cid = NULL, $table = NULL, $wildcard = FALSE) ]
Expire data from the cache. If called without arguments, expirable entries will be cleared from the cache_page and cache_block tables.

cache_get
[cache_get($key, $table = 'cache') ]
Return data from the persistent cache. Data may be stored as either plain text or as serialized data. cache_get will automatically return unserialized objects and arrays.

cache_set
[cache_set]
Store data in the persistent cache.
